Clearaudio Celebrity Al Di Meola Edition Mirrors an Instrument’s Form

— February 23, 2026 — Tech
The Clearaudio Celebrity Al Di Meola Edition turntable adopts the silhouette of an electric guitar in a collaboration between high-end audio maker Clearaudio and Grammy-winning jazz guitarist Al Di Meola, using its unusual body shape as a tribute to his primary instrument.

The chassis is crafted from high-density wood fibre and is available in black or real rosewood veneer, with the traditional guitar volume control reimagined as a multifunctional touch dial that manages power and rotational speed. The package is limited to 1,000 numbered pieces worldwide and includes a specially pressed album and a custom guitar pick as part of the collector set. Technical features include a 30 mm main platter driven by a precision flat belt paired with Clearaudio’s Tacho Speed Control system, which monitors and adjusts speed in real time to maintain stability at 33 ⅓ and 45 RPM.

Trend Themes
1. Instrument-shaped Consumer Electronics - Designs that mimic musical instrument silhouettes are redefining product identity and creating strong emotional and aesthetic appeal for niche audiences.
2. Limited-edition Collector Audio - Scarcity-driven releases with numbered units and bundled memorabilia are transforming audio hardware into collectible assets with resale and fandom-driven value.
3. Multifunctional Analog Controls - Traditional mechanical controls are being reinterpreted as tactile, multi-use interfaces that blend analog feel with digital precision monitoring.
Industry Implications
1. High-end Audio - Premium audio firms are positioned to merge artisanal craftsmanship with advanced stabilization and monitoring systems to attract audiophile collectors.
2. Luxury Consumer Goods - Luxury brands can capitalize on bespoke materials and limited runs to elevate everyday electronics into status-driven lifestyle pieces.
3. Music Merchandise & Memorabilia - The convergence of branded instruments and playback devices is expanding the scope of music-related collectibles beyond apparel and posters.
